India records 602 fresh Covid cases, 5 deaths in 24 hours; 511 cases of JN.1 reported till Tuesday

IndiaTimes Wednesday, 3 January 2024
ndia has reported 602 fresh cases of Covid-19 in 24 hours, Union health ministry data updated on Wednesday showed. The Integrated Disease Surveillance Programme (IDSP), under the National Centre for Disease Control (NCDC), has reported five deaths due to Covid in 24 hours in India. A total of 511 cases of the JN.1 variant have been reported from 11 states till January 2. The active caseload declined to 4,440, with a drop of 125 since Tuesday, health ministry data showed.
